The Ethereum Revolution: A Timeless Analysis

Ethereum, often symbolized as ETH, stands as a titan in the world of blockchain technology. Unlike Bitcoin, which is primarily a digital currency, Ethereum is a decentralized platform that facilitates smart contracts and decentralized applications (dApps). This dual functionality gives Ethereum a unique proposition within the cryptocurrency sphere, making it a cornerstone of blockchain innovation.

An Overview: Advantages and Disadvantages of Ethereum

One of Ethereum's main advantages is its flexibility through smart contracts and dApps, which can automate transactions and operations without intermediaries. This reduces costs and enhances security and transparency. Ethereum's robust developer community continuously works to improve and innovate, fostering a vibrant ecosystem.

However, Ethereum is not without its challenges. The network has often faced scalability issues, resulting in slower transaction speeds and higher fees, particularly during peak usage times. While efforts like Ethereum 2.0 aim to address these limitations, the transition is both complex and ongoing, presenting uncertainty for some users and developers.

Development Trajectory: The Past of Ethereum

Ethereum was proposed by Vitalik Buterin in late 2013 and officially launched in 2015 with the goal of building a functional, flexible blockchain platform. Over the years, Ethereum has undergone several major upgrades, notably the switch from a Proof-of-Work to a Proof-of-Stake consensus mechanism. This transition, part of Ethereum 2.0, aims to improve security, scalability, and sustainability.

Ethereum's journey has been marked by significant milestones such as the "Hard Fork" that created Ethereum Classic and the introduction of numerous ERC standards that have enabled a plethora of tokenized solutions and Initial Coin Offerings (ICOs).

Future Prospects: Where is Ethereum Headed?

Looking to the future, Ethereum's prospects appear promising, particularly with the ongoing development of Ethereum 2.0, which seeks to address scalability issues through innovative solutions like sharding. This upgrade is expected to enable Ethereum to process thousands of transactions per second, vastly improving efficiency.

The growth of decentralized finance (DeFi) and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s) on the Ethereum platform highlights its central role in the blockchain ecosystem. As industries continue to explore blockchain solutions, Ethereum's established infrastructure positions it well for future expansion and adoption.

However, competition is fierce. New blockchain platforms like Solana and Cardano are vying for market share by offering faster and cheaper transaction solutions. Ethereum must maintain its innovative edge and community support to continue its dominance.

BONGO CAT

Introduction to BONGO CAT

BONGO CAT is a relatively new player in the cryptocurrency market, symbolized by its token "bongo." With an innovative approach and a vibrant community, BONGO CAT has quickly garnered attention since its inception. As of now, it is priced at approximately $0.127, reflecting significant recent volatility and activity. This article will delve into the advantages and disadvantages of BONGO CAT, examine its historical price movements, and explore its future prospects in the crypto space.

Historical Price Dynamics

The history of BONGO CAT has been marked by considerable fluctuations. Its all-time low (ATL) was recorded at approximately $0.000021, while it recently touched its all-time high (ATH) of $0.124. This dramatic rise of about 587,596% from the ATL to the ATH indicates the potential for considerable gains, albeit with corresponding risks. The token's price has recently soared, demonstrating a price change of around 57.15% over the past 24 hours—an indicator of its volatile nature and the active trading environment it operates within.

Advantages of BONGO CAT

One of the primary strengths of BONGO CAT lies in its community-driven approach. Projects that emphasize community engagement often foster loyalty and active participation, which can contribute positively to long-term value. The marketing efforts around BONGO CAT have effectively utilized social media and meme culture, capitalizing on trends to create a unique brand identity.

Additionally, BONGO CAT has a low current price, making it accessible for new investors looking to enter the cryptocurrency market without significant financial exposure. Its market cap of approximately $126 million suggests that while it is still a smaller player, it may have room for growth, especially if it can maintain its momentum and broaden its user base.

Disadvantages of BONGO CAT

Despite its potential, BONGO CAT also faces several challenges. One major risk is its inherent volatility, as evidenced by its dramatic price shifts in a short period. Such fluctuations can deter risk-averse investors and create an unstable trading environment.

Furthermore, like many cryptocurrencies, BONGO CAT is subject to regulatory scrutiny, which could impact its adoption and usability. The project lacks the foundational technology and established user base that more prominent cryptocurrencies possess, potentially limiting its long-term viability.

The Future of BONGO CAT

The future outlook for BONGO CAT largely depends on several factors. Continued community engagement and innovative marketing strategies will be crucial in sustaining its popularity. Moreover, partnerships and strategic developments can provide additional use cases for the coin, potentially stabilizing its price.

Given the recent price surge, if BONGO CAT can capitalize on current market trends and build a more extensive ecosystem around its token, it may see significant growth in the coming years. However, potential investors should approach with caution, as the cryptocurrency market is notoriously unpredictable.
